Shell structure

The shell of turtles around the world consists of two shields: dorsal and abdominal. They are interconnected. The shell has openings for the head, legs, and tail. With the approaching danger, the tortoise is hiding in its shelter.

In some species of this animal, the shell is soft, but it is quite durable. Therefore, the formidable predator will not be able to bite him. The shell serves as a real protection for the turtle. Indeed, by nature she is clumsy and slow, and the “house with herself” will always save and hide from ill-wishers.

Pond slider

The most beautiful representative of the turtle world is red-eared. This is a freshwater turtle that has a shell size of more than 25 centimeters. The beautiful reptile has been growing for many years. Over 1.5 years, the shell of a red-eared turtle reaches a diameter of about 7.5 cm. Then it continues to grow more slowly, adding 1 cm per year. The shell of a red-eared turtle can reach a maximum length of 30 centimeters.

She herself hails from the southeastern United States. Outwardly, he is a pretty creature. On both sides of the head, the turtle has scarlet spots, for which it was called “red-eared”. Although in reality she does not have ears. It is interesting that the shell of the red-eared turtles is able to change color depending on their age and habitat. In young individuals, light shades prevail, in adults - darker tones, down to black.

Turtle upkeep

Russian lovers of the living corner willingly acquire this particular type of turtle. The point is not only in the bright color of the reptile, but also in its unpretentiousness. But there are some features that should be considered.

For example, it is a mistake to choose a small terrarium for the red-eared bug . After all, the reptile will grow up and require more and more space. It is necessary to stock up on 100-150 liters of terrarim. It must provide for a dry space, and the water level must exceed the size of the tortoise shell.

It is recommended to change the water in the aquarium 1-2 times a week and maintain the temperature in it at least + 20-26 ° C. If these rules are neglected, then after a while, spots of an unhealthy color can be found on the carapace of the animal. Connoisseurs advise putting an aquarium with a turtle in a sunny place, as a pet likes to soak in the warm rays.

The health of the turtle, including the condition of its shell, is directly dependent on nutrition. It must be balanced. On sale there is a considerable amount of feed for turtles, but not all mineral and vitamin supplements are taken into account in them.

This will sooner or later affect the health of the reptile. In parallel with this, you can find that the red-eared turtle has a soft shell, which is not its natural feature. Supplement the diet with finely chopped fresh fish. Moths and earthworms can serve as excellent feed additives for turtles.

Carapace - an indicator of health

Carapace of turtles often suffers from traumatic injury. Especially for this are land reptiles. The cause may be the fall of the turtle from a height. Sometimes a turtle can be accidentally stepped on or pinched in the doorway.

That is why the tortoise shell should be periodically inspected for cracks, scratches and other changes. If the owner noticed stains on the shell of a turtle or a suspicious color change, this may indicate the presence of secondary bacterial and fungal microflora. Such lesions can lead to partial or complete destruction of the shell. With such signs, you should immediately consult a doctor!

Shell softening

Consider the reasons why the tortoiseshell becomes soft. If this is not due to a natural feature, then, most likely, this is due to the lack of calcium in the body of the animal. This also indicates the non-observance of the rules for the maintenance of the turtle, a lack of ultraviolet rays and a lack of vitamin D.

If you notice, for example, that the red-eared turtle has a soft shell, then hurry to the doctor for examination. Only he can say for sure what caused this phenomenon and what needs to be done. Often reptile owners notice spots on the shell of a turtle in the form of algae. If they are poorly expressed and there are not many, then there is nothing to worry about. If the turtle is “overgrown” with such a pattern, attention should be paid to water pollution and lighting. White spots on the tortoise shell can indicate the presence of fungus. Self-treatment of reptiles is not recommended. In any case, if spots are seen on the shell of a red-eared turtle, it is better to consult a herpetologist in time.

Musk turtle

why does the tortoise shell

The musk turtle is the smallest in the world. Its habitats are water bodies of the USA and Canada. This creation of nature weighs a little more than 200 grams. The length of the turtle is about 8 centimeters, the carapace reaches about 6-7 centimeters. As a defense, the reptile can exude a rather unpleasant odor due to the fluid that accumulates in her back of the carapace. The turtle is omnivorous and unpretentious. The diet of her diet includes small fish, various aquatic vegetation.

Roof turtle

Unusual structure among turtles stands out roofing. Her homeland is India. The shell of this interesting turtle is about 40 cm long.

The reptile has a keel on its back. Especially striking is the backward-directed tooth on the third vertebral flap. The coloring of the roofing turtle is excellent!

The belly of the reptile is reddish yellow with clear black spots. The head and nape are highlighted in bright red. The shell, bordered by a light yellow ribbon, plays with greenish-brown hues.

Female turtles lay their eggs in sand or in rotten plants. The number of eggs can be from 7 to 100 pieces. Hatching from them, little turtles rush to the water, considering it their refuge.

But already along the way, reptiles can serve as food for various predators: crabs and birds. They all want to taste tortoise meat. However, reptiles can also be eaten in water. Simply, being in the water, the turtles move faster, and they have more chances of survival.
